Dr. Alelujah Ramirez graduated from the University of Texas at Austin with a Bachelor of Science in Psychology. She then went on to earn her Doctor of Optometry from the University of Houston.
While in optometry school, Dr. Ramirez’s clinical externships allowed her to provide full scope optometric care to patients at Cedar Springs Eye Clinic located in the inner city of Dallas, and Golden Eye Clinic, a high-volume rural practice in East Texas. At both of her externship sites, she not only managed a variety of ocular diseases, but she also became proficient in specialty contact lens fittings. Additionally, she was selected to work at the Myopia Control Clinic at the University Eye Institute where she was trained in different treatment strategies to reduce myopia progression in children.
After graduating with her Doctor of Optometry degree, Dr. Ramirez completed her residency in refractive surgery and ocular disease at Parkhurst NuVision in San Antonio, Texas. Throughout her residency, she developed a passion for providing care in a perioperative setting to both refractive and cataract patients. She continued managing ocular pathology with an emphasis on anterior segment diseases including keratoconus, dry eye, and more.
Dr. Ramirez is passionate about teaching and helping others. Beyond her clinical experience, Dr. Ramirez served as a teaching assistant for two years during optometry school and continued teaching as a preceptor for fourth year optometry students while in residency. She also recently travelled to Mexico to help provide over 200 cataract surgeries to the indigent peoples within the state of Chihuahua and surrounding areas.
